Fill in the blank with the correct response.


If x is a whole number and 437 = (21 + x)(21 - x), then x = ?

437 = (21 + x)(21 - x)

(21 + x)(21 - x) = 437             {(a + b)(a - b)= a² - b²}

21² - x² = 437

441 - x² = 437          {subtract 441 from both sides}

-x² = 437 - 441  

-x² = - 4             {Divide both sides by [-1] }

x² = 4

x² = 2²

x = 2
